- В исходном коде выбираем все папки и файлы, кроме:
- .vscode
- files
- logs
- .gitignore
- package-lock.json

Выбранные файлы добавляем в zip архив. В результате формирования будет создан архив.

2. Запускаем командную строку и выполняем в ней следующий запрос:
scp [path_to_file] [username]@[host]:[local_path] # пример ниже #scp "D:\developer\cic\node-service\node-service.zip" a-krasnov@cic.it-serv.ru:/var/www/node-deploy.zip
Указанный выше запрос загружает файл на сервер.
3. Заходим на сервер через Putty и находим в нем файл *-deploy.sh

И запускаем его.
Примечание: имя передаваемого файла важно, т.к. оно должно совпадать с наименованием в bash-скрипте.
